Challenges and Sustainable Solution for Furniture Waste Management in Selected Higher Educational Institutions of Vadodara City
Author(s) | Suraksha Narang, Urvashi Mishra |
---|---|
Country | India |
Abstract | In recent years, solid waste management has gained significant attention as a global issue, with particular focus on waste streams like plastic, glass, and others, being addressed by governments, researchers, and experts. However, furniture waste management is still in its early stages. Specifically, in higher educational institutions, this issue remains a significant challenge for various reasons. This study highlights the key challenges faced by selected higher educational institutions in Vadodara City regarding furniture waste management. The descriptive analysis reveals that a lack of policies and awareness significantly impacts the effectiveness of waste management efforts. Additionally, the study offers practical solutions for managing furniture waste sustainably, with up-cycling being highlighted as a successful approach to address the issue. |
